CalendarActivity.java :  » UnTagged » sw6android » sw6 » visualschedule » entities » Android Open Source

Android Open Source » UnTagged » sw6android 
sw6android » sw6 » visualschedule » entities » CalendarActivity.java
package sw6.visualschedule.entities;

import java.util.Date;

public class CalendarActivity extends AbstractActivity<CalendarStep> {

  private Date mDateTime;
  private boolean mFinished;
  
  public CalendarActivity(CalendarActivityTemplate template, Date startTime, String title) {
    super(title);
    this.mDateTime = startTime;
  }
  
  public CalendarActivity(CalendarActivityTemplate template, Date startTime) {
      this(template, startTime, template.getTitle());
  }  

  /* Getters and setters */
  
  public void setDateTime(Date dateTime) {
    this.mDateTime = dateTime;
  }

  public Date getDateTime() {
    return mDateTime;
  }

  public void setFinished(boolean finished) {
    this.mFinished = finished;
  }

  public boolean isFinished() {
    return mFinished;
  }
  
  @Override
  public String toString() {
    return getTitle() + " | " + mDateTime.toLocaleString();
  }

}
java2s.com  | Contact Us | Privacy Policy
Copyright 2009 - 12 Demo Source and Support. All rights reserved.
All other trademarks are property of their respective owners.